As of June 30, SHFCU had 684 members and assets of more than $2.8 million, according to a release.
DFFCU was chosen as the partner because of its extensive products and services, advanced online access and shared branching. The firefighters credit union also is keeping SHFCU employees and the existing branch location.
“We are excited to merge with Dayton Firefighters Federal Credit Union. Our members have been asking for expanded services and we can now offer full service financial products. We look forward to continuing to service our members as well as the current Dayton Firefighters Federal Credit Union members,” said Amy Comer, SHFCU manager and CEO.
DFFCU is open to anyone who lives, works, worships or attends school in Montgomery, Greene or Miami counties. They now have combined assets of about $63 million with about 5,200 members.
“We look forward to providing a full range of deposit and loan products to the members joining the DFFCU family from SHFCU. After data processing systems are combined, we will be able to provide financial services to the members at both Dayton locations, 338 S. Patterson Blvd. and 5000 Burkhardt Road,” said Thomas Newton, DFFCU president and CEO.
